  • The Birth of American Classical Music: Dvořák, Gershwin & Copland

    Longmont Museum 400 Quail Rd., Longmont, CO, United States

    Antonín Dvořák’s American Quartet (1893) inspired American composers to create music that reflected their own culture. George Gershwin’s “Lullaby” (1919) represents one of the earliest attempts, while Aaron Copland’s “Appalachian Spring” stands as a quintessential expression of the country’s simplicity and optimism (1944).
